Output fcf57372f3fb2df646a99d68330c49755688f75fa0a9a1a8b70caaafc080dd16:1

value
26545606
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dbbea73a252f71ddf0e7b028fd9f5eed3501c1c6 OP_EQUAL
address
3MivJNcA3TymUohFgPnBJtxSYNADN3mhm6
transaction
fcf57372f3fb2df646a99d68330c49755688f75fa0a9a1a8b70caaafc080dd16
confirmations
151479
spent
true